"An Early Death Sentence": Fonasa and Isapres Rejected More than 16,000 Licenses for Cancer Patients, Many in Terminal State

Summary by The Clinic
Medical licenses rejected to cancer patients have gone up. 26% correspond to cases of "unrecoverable diagnosis".
